How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Universal City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Universal City Studio Apartments | $967 | $725 | $1,350 |
| Universal City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,097 | $695 | $2,560 |
| Universal City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,318 | $850 | $2,593 |
| Universal City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,730 | $1,199 | $4,492 |
| Universal City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,409 | $1,524 | $2,625 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Universal City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Universal City?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Universal City is at Falcon Ridge Apartments listed at $695.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Universal City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Universal City is $1,513.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Universal City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Universal City is a 2,964 square feet unit starting from $1,500 at 8709 Azul Sky Ct.
What is the average size for Universal City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Universal City is currently at 876 sq ft.
